Aberystwyth South Beach
Aberystwyth south beach is a sheltered sand and shingle beach sandwiched between the castle and the harbour breakwater.
Popular surfing location “harbour trap”. Although, can become crowded.
All the facilities of being in the centre of a large town, car parking at harbour, castle or in the town, summer lifeguards.
